zblog伪静态?为什么要做zblog伪静态因为伪静态有利于搜索引擎的收录,能够增加网站的优化效果,但要注意做伪静态的时候,一定要正确书写好代码,一旦出现失误,会导致搜索引擎抓取出现异常,需要对伪静态进行测试及及时跟踪。顺便给大家推荐一款zblog插件多个功能。一键建站+内容以及资源采集+伪原创+主动推送给搜索引擎收录等下会以图片的形式给大家展示。大家注意看图。
{%host%}:表示的是网址,以/结尾
{%category%}:表示分类,如果分类有别名则调用别名,没有别名则调用名称
注:此参数只有文章的url配置中出现
{%alias%}:表示调用的别名,如没有别名则调用标题或名称
注意:此参数会出现在 文章页,页面,分类,标签页,作者页的url配置中
{%id%}:表示数据在数据库中储存的ID号,以数字来表示
注:此参数会出现在作者页,标签页,分类页,文章页,页面的url配置中
{%year%}:表示数据新建立的年份,如 2022 2023 等
{%month%}:表示数据新建立的月份,如 05 12 等
{%date%}:表示时间段,不常用,一般用于日期页的ur配置
注:此参数只会出现在一些列表页面,比如首页,文章列表,标签列表,作者文章列表,日期页列表的url配置中
伪静态的url可以使用以上参数与一些字符串进行任意组合,但要注意几点
1、{%host%} 参数与其它字符串或参数组合时,不能出现 / 符号
2、除 {%host%} 参数外,其它参数的组合,可以使用 / 符号
3、使用 {%alias%} 参数时,输出的结果中不得出现中文或其它特殊符号
4、列表页面的url配置中,必需含有 {%page%} 参数,不然会出现BUG
5、你可以参考以下的几个示例,来配置url
当然我们完全可以实现站点内大部分页面都是静态页面,但动态页面在优化的过程中也起到重要作用,为了安全,把动态页面设置成伪静态,就能满足搜索引擎这些要求。
早期网站没有动态语言,例如(asp/jsp/)等等的支持,所有页面写HTML,然后保存为扩展名为.html供浏览。后来出现了动态语言和数据库相结合以后,更多的交互性很强的网站就出现在我们面前,访问地址就变成了带有"?"等。
早期搜索引擎对于这些动态参数的形式页面不容易收录,于是将这些动态页面转化成以html结尾的静态页面,这些页面是真正的静态页面,保存在服务器的硬盘上。因此随着数据的不断增加,会对网站的访问速度造成严重的影响,于是一种URLRewrite(URL重写)即伪静态技术出现了,避免了真正静态文件的大量产生。
伪静态有什么好处
静态页面空间储存量大,删除或更新这些html文件可造成大量的垃圾页面,而蜘蛛一样去抓取,有非常多的垃圾索引。而伪静态可以更好的环节服务器压力,增强搜索引擎对页面的收录,动态页面虽然实时更新,但有时会导致死循环,对搜索引擎不友好,而伪静态不会出现这样的情况。
0 留言